The Okinawa Airport Shuttle, the Yanbaru Express and bus line 117 directly connect the airport and city center of Naha with the Churaumi Aquarium. The one way trip takes a little over two hours and costs 2000 yen on the Okinawa Airport Shuttle and the Yanbaru Express and 2440-2550 yen on bus 117.

Secondly, how do I get to Naha? By ferry. Kagoshima (Kagoshima New Port) and Naha (Naha Port) are connected by ferries operated by A Line Ferry and Marix Line. Both companies have departures every other day (on alternating days), and the trip takes about 25 hours. Fares start at around 15,500 yen one way for second class.

How do I get from Naha airport to city?

The single monorail line operates between Naha Airport and Shuri Station, a 15-20 minute walk from Shuri Castle, and runs through the city center, meeting the Kokusaidori twice at Asahibashi Station and Makishi Station. Asahibashi Station is also close to the Naha Bus Terminal.
